About Seattle

Seattle is a vibrant hub of innovation and culture, renowned for its significant contributions to the technology and aerospace industries. With a population of over 750,000, Seattle is home to major corporations such as Amazon, Microsoft, and Boeing, alongside a dynamic mix of startups, small businesses, and cultural institutions. Key industries in Seattle include technology, aerospace, healthcare, and maritime services.

Seattle's diverse landscape offers an impressive variety of team building experiences that cater to different interests and preferences. From engaging scavenger hunts in Pike Place Market to thrilling escape rooms in Capitol Hill, the options are endless. Teams can enjoy interactive cooking classes in Ballard, embark on food tours through the historic streets of Pioneer Square, or participate in improv workshops in Fremont. Whether you are organizing a corporate retreat, an employee appreciation event, or a small team outing, Seattle provides a wealth of group activities to match any company culture and budget.

Seattle team building FAQs

Seattle offers a variety of top-rated team building activities, including the popular scavenger hunts around Pike Place Market, escape rooms, and interactive cooking classes. Outdoor enthusiasts may enjoy kayaking on Lake Union or hiking in the nearby Cascade Mountains. Each activity provides a unique opportunity to strengthen team bonds and boost morale.

The average price per person for team building activities in Seattle typically ranges from $25 to $150. The cost depends on the type of activity, duration, and any additional services included.

Seattle offers a variety of venues perfect for hosting team building events, including the waterfront Bell Harbor International Conference Center and the versatile spaces at AXIS Pioneer Square. For a more unique experience, consider the Museum of Pop Culture or a private room at the Chihuly Garden and Glass, both providing inspiring environments for team activities.

It is recommended to book team events in Seattle at least 4 to 6 weeks in advance. This allows for better availability of dates and a wider selection of activities, especially during peak seasons.

In Seattle, you can incorporate local experiences like sailing on Puget Sound, exploring Pike Place Market with a scavenger hunt, or engaging in a glass-blowing workshop inspired by the city's vibrant art scene. These activities provide a unique way to immerse your team in the local culture while fostering collaboration and creativity.

Absolutely, many team building providers in Seattle offer customizable options to tailor the activities to your group's specific needs and goals. You can work with them to adjust the duration, focus, and even the location to ensure a memorable and effective experience for your team.

Rescheduling or canceling a team building event in Seattle typically depends on the policies of the specific provider you have chosen. Most providers offer a flexible rescheduling policy if you notify them in advance, but they may have a cancellation fee if you cancel too close to the event date. It is important to review the terms and conditions of your booking for detailed information.

Seattle offers a variety of unique venues for team building activities, including the Museum of Pop Culture, which provides interactive exhibits and creative workshops. Another option is the Seattle Glassblowing Studio, where teams can participate in hands-on glassblowing experiences. For a more outdoor-oriented venue, consider the Woodland Park Zoo, which offers team-oriented scavenger hunts and exclusive animal encounters.
